Sarah Michelle Gellar

Sarah enjoys rollerblading, ice skating, water skiing, and occasionally
goes cliff diving. She was a competitive figure skater for 3 years and was
ranked 3rd in the New York Sate regional competition. She has taken 5 years of
Tae Kwon Do and is active in physical fitness. Sarah is an only child and
considers herself a workaholic. She attended high school at Professional Children's
School in New York and graduated two years early with a 4.0.

Sarah began her acting career at age 4 when she was discovered by an agent
while eating in a local restaurant. Three weeks later she was on the set of
her first film, An Invasion of Privacy. This chance discovery was to later
boost her professional career which has lasted 18 of her 21 years of life.
In addition to having been one of the two regular hostesses of the TV talk
show, "Girl Talk," Sarah is a veteran of TV, film, and stage.

She has appeared with Matthew Broderick and Eric Stoltz in The Widow Claire
at the Circle in the Square, and had a feature film open in which she costarred
with Sally Kirkland and Robert Lupone. She has appeared on Spenser:
For Hire, Love, Sidney, The David Letterman Show and The Regis Philbin
Show. She has done over 100 commercials and is a Wilhelmina Model. She has also
appeared in Crossbow which she filmed in France and Switzerland.

Sarah played Molly in the original cast of Neil Simon's Jake's Women and
young Jacqueline Bouvier in the award winning NBC mini-series A Woman Named
Jackie. Sarah started to gain a small, but loyal, fanbase when she played
the lead role of Sydney Rutledge in the teen soap opera, Swans Crossing.
In 1996, Sarah was picked as the lead of a new series called Buffy the
Vampire Slayer, based on the movie by the same name. Warner Brothers bought
13 episodes of the show, and although ratings of the pilot were the highest
ever of any of the WB lineup, it ranked 100th out of 107 programs in
the Nielson ratings.

Warner Brothers renewed the show for another 22 episodes which will begin
airing September 15th. In June, Sarah finished shooting I Know What You Did
Last Summer, which stars her and Jennifer Love Hewitt as teens that try to
cover up a hit and run. It was released on October 17th and became number one
that weekend, earning a profit in just two days. Shortly after filming I
Know What You Did Last Summer, Sarah flew down to Atlanta, GA to film Scream 2,
which had the largest December opening of a film and made more money
in it's first weekend than the other top 9 films combined.
